SYNCASET vol.2 Moves to a Bigger Tokyo Venue for Nov. 8, 2026 — With Cassette-Only Releases from Every Act

Japanese label COMPLEX and Tokyo venue Aoyama 月見ル君想フ (Tsukimi ru Kimi Omou) are jointly presenting SYNCASET vol.2 on Sunday, November 8, 2026, at HOME/WORK VILLAGE Gymnasium in Ikejiri-Ohashi, Tokyo, with support from CASSETTE EXPRESS. The concept: every performing artist releases a cassette made specifically for that day in limited quantities, then plays it live. Fans can pick up the day-only tapes on site, inside a venue that's a converted former junior-high-school gymnasium.

Compared to the spring vol.1, held at Aoyama's Tsukimi ru Kimi Omou, this edition has more than doubled its artist count — and moved to a bigger space to match.

Taniguchi Yu, long known as a supporting player and track producer for many artists, is described by the organizers as a consummate character actor of a musician — here he finally brings a solo work of his own. Three-piece rock band Saraba Teikoku has drawn praise for its recently released track "OCEAN BEAT"; Kyo Eiichi's band Yukiguni is currently touring six cities nationwide behind "claras."
